Campus Energy Reduction Plan Winter Intersession

Many buildings will be unoccupied or less occupied during the coming winter intersession. UMass Amherst Physical Plant is implementing a plan to reduce energy consumption from the end of the fall semester on Dec. 18, 2021 through Jan. 24, 2022, before spring semester starts.

Its success will require your individual cooperation to help reduce utility costs. This includes heating buildings and spaces during occupied hours, and lowering the heating temperature set points during unoccupied hours.

This Energy Reduction Plan will not be implemented in laboratory and research areas, the Campus Center Parking Garage, the police station and other buildings or spaces which require continuous operation.

The following practices are strongly encouraged while away from your offices:

  • Shut off all electric equipment that does not need to be on while you are away.
  • Turn off all the lights when you leave your office.
  • Turn off your computer and monitor, and shut down other office equipment like copiers while away from your office.
  • Turn the thermostat knob (where available and accessible) to 2 or 1, or reset the room thermostat (where available and accessible) to 55 degrees Fahrenheit.
  • Keep windows and exterior doors closed.
  • If the fume hood in the lab is not in use, close the sash completely.
  • Turn off any other equipment that may use energy unnecessarily.
  • Be aware of campus security; keep areas locked.
